How Europol is cozying up to Microsoft, Palantir, Clearview & Co.

Heise, 10 November 2025.

Support our work: become a Friend of Statewatch from as little as £1/€1 per month.

"Europol is intensifying its cooperation with US tech companies. The civil rights organization Statewatch criticizes this alliance in a research report as opaque and a source of massive conflicts of interest. The cooperation is reportedly so close that Microsoft employees already have their own workstations at the EU police agency's headquarters in The Hague."
